Default 3.4 Upgrading

ok so since my parents wont let me get a new car i wanna upgrade my 3.4
can i put a z28 camshaft in it?
the lifters and heads are new so i just need the camshaft
where can i get good lower rearend gears from?
does a 3400 impala engine bolt up to my trasmission? because if so i could take it to a engine place and just get a newer impala 3400 engine

Default RE: 3.4 Upgrading

Z28 cam - No. It has sixteen lobes whereas yours has twelve. Not to mention it's for a V8.
Rear gears - Any performance website
3400 engine - won't bolt up I believe, but I was thinking you could swap out the top end on them with yours. Look up "3.4 camaro top end swap", and you'll see some things. It entails heads and intake manifold.

Default RE: 3.4 Upgrading

As Loren said, the transverse engines used in front drive cars do not have mounting provisions for installing them in rear drive cars. You can use the top(heads & intake)of the transverse engine but not the block or camshaft.

Default RE: 3.4 Upgrading

Yes, I would have it dyno-tuned. While mail order tunes are good, it's best to have someone who is seeing how your car runs, to tune it. If I remember right, swapping out the heads and manifold is going to raise the compression ratio, hence the need for tuning.
